Step One: Understand the Type of Care Your Loved One Needs
Before you begin your search, it is important to identify the specific kind of care your loved one requires. Are they facing early-stage dementia or Alzheimer’s and in need of dementia care? Do they need companionship and supervision while you are at work? Is the priority personal hygiene, mobility support, or emotional connection?
Incare offers different levels of care depending on these needs:
- Personal care for tasks such as bathing, grooming, and toileting
- Companion care to reduce isolation and provide emotional support
- Respite care to allow family caregivers a needed break during the week
- Specialized care for seniors with unique conditions such as stroke, cancer, or memory loss
Understanding these needs ensures your care plan is tailored, not generic, and keeps your loved one safe, engaged, and respected.

Step Three: Ask the Right Questions
As you begin reaching out to agencies or searching online for how to find a caregiver in NYC, focus on more than just availability or hourly rate. Ask:
- Has the caregiver received formal training, such as certification as a home health aide or certified nursing assistant?
- Do they have extensive experience with conditions like Alzheimer’s, Parkinson’s, or heart disease?
- Will they assist with activities of daily living and also offer companionship and emotional support?
- Can they escort your loved one to medical appointments, provide medication reminders, or prepare healthy meals?
- How does the agency perform background checks and supervise care?

What are in-home care services and who are they for?
In-home care services cover a range of non-medical support provided in a person’s residence. This includes assistance with daily activities, medication reminders, light housekeeping, and companionship. Seniors who prefer to remain in their own home rather than move to nursing homes often benefit from these services.
What does companion care involve?
Companion care focuses on emotional connection, conversation, and engagement through activities that bring joy and mental stimulation. At Incare, companion caregivers help seniors with social interaction, errands, and attending events or support groups, and are especially helpful for clients who live alone or feel isolated.
